GIBO HOLDINGS Ltd (NASDAQ:GIBO) Sees Large Decrease in Short Interest

GIBO HOLDINGS Ltd (NASDAQ:GIBOGet Free Report) saw a significant drop in short interest in July. As of July 31st, there was short interest totaling 2,263 shares, a drop of 40.4% from the July 15th total of 3,800 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 7,874 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.3 days. Currently, 1.5% of the company’s stock are sold short.

GIBO Stock Performance

GIBO stock opened at $29.11 on Monday. GIBO has a fifty-two week low of $22.60 and a fifty-two week high of $203.50. The firm’s 50-day simple moving average is $29.64 and its 200 day simple moving average is $32.93.

GIBO (NASDAQ:GIBOG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 15th. The company reported ($812.50) EPS for the quarter.

About GIBO

Global IBO Group Ltd. is a unique and integrated AIGC animation creation and streaming platform for storytellers and content creators. Global IBO Group Ltd., formerly known as Bukit Jalil Global Acquisition 1 Ltd., is based in NEW YORK.
